Brady speech clinic provides initial screenings, parent consultations, comprehensive evaluations, scheduled therapy sessions, family counseling and support, and collaboration with schools, physicians, & other paraprofessionals.

Arnell Brady

Arnell Brady has over 25 years of experience as a direct clinical service provider for pediatric and adult populations in hospitals and schools. Nursing rehabilitation agencies, in-home, and private clinics. While building a private practice, Mr. Brady also worked as a staff speech-language pathologist at the University of Chicago Hospitals, senior speech-language pathologist at St. Joseph’s Hospital, and chief speech-language pathologist at Provident Hosptial of Cook County.

Today, he directs and provides direct clinical services specializing in diagnostic and treatment/training protocols based in neuroplasticity. He is a graduate of Northwestern University’s (Evanston, Illinois) and Saint Xavier College’s (Chicago, Illinois) speech-language pathology programs. Mr. Brady is the 2009-2011 Chairman of the National Board of Directors for the National Black Association for Speech-Language Hearing. He also is a member of the Multicultural Issues Board of the American Speech-Language Hearing Association.
